**TICKET-4412: BloomGate credentials expired**

Plugin authors: the shared key for BloomGate, the bloom filter layer in front of the Hollowvale KV store, expired Tuesday. All membership checks now fall through to the store directly. Expect latency until you rotate. Old keys are revoked; do not retry with them. Update your plugin config with the replacement key below.

service key, tadup-tahog: zpat7_wB1tnEL

For: Finance Team

Our partner Quillon Dynamics delivered a term sheet last week proposing co-investment in the Skylark analytics platform. Headline terms: 40% funding share, board observer seat, and a revenue split tilted in their favor for the first two years. Legal has flagged the exclusivity clause as unusually broad. Please model three funding scenarios before the planning session, including a walk-away case. Our negotiating position and fallback strategy are captured in the confidential note below.

confidential, fafog-fafog: Only 21 of the 82 pilot accounts renewed Holwyn, so a churn review is set for September 1. Normirox Logistics is in early talks to buy Praiusox Foods for about $134.2 million.

## Deployment

Quick notes for the sync: the Gallerywren audio-guide app deploys via the usual pipeline — push to main, wait for the build, then promote staging to prod from the dashboard. Audio assets ship separately through the media bucket, so a code deploy won't break existing tours. One gotcha: the transcoder worker needs a manual restart after config changes, which bites us about once a month. Prod and staging share most settings except the CDN origin. The current prod configuration looks like this:

deployment values, kajep-kageg:
[praix]
host = praix.paliqcorp.corp
user = praix_svc
database = praix_prod

# Break-Glass: Catalog Cache Invalidation

Scope: the Pinrow product catalog at Veldstone Retail. If stale prices persist after a purge and the Hollowmere invalidation queue is wedged, use break-glass to flush the edge tier directly. Contractors: get verbal sign-off from the catalog lead first. Steps: open the Hollowmere admin shell, select emergency-flush, confirm the tenant, and run it once — repeated flushes thrash the origin. Access is logged and expires after 20 minutes. Unseal the admin shell with the passphrase below.

recovery phrase for kahop-tajog: istix-casvan